Skip to content

On Xcode 13 "flutter build ios -v" prints warning that there are multiple matching destinations #87136

@jmagman

Description

@jmagman

With Xcode 13 installed, flutter build ios -v warns there are multiple iOS targets:

$ flutter build ios  -v
...
                   ** BUILD SUCCEEDED **


                    --- xcodebuild: WARNING: Using the first of multiple matching destinations:
                    { platform:iOS, id:dvtdevice-DVTiPhonePlaceholder-iphoneos:placeholder, name:Any iOS Device }
                    { platform:iOS Simulator, id:dvtdevice-DVTiOSDeviceSimulatorPlaceholder-iphonesimulator:placeholder, name:Any iOS Simulator
                    Device }
                    { platform:iOS Simulator, id:1D5FCF87-522E-43B7-AA01-757578491DEE, OS:15.0, name:TestAdd2AppSim }
                    { platform:iOS Simulator, id:6996EFF7-2924-4561-9031-0B067C1993C2, OS:15.0, name:iPad (8th generation) }
                    { platform:iOS Simulator, id:FFCCE84F-38CE-4532-9260-DE32A9AD162E, OS:15.0, name:iPad Air (4th generation) }
                    { platform:iOS Simulator, id:D260F448-6C56-4440-B6F1-DCD60D9A415F, OS:15.0, name:iPad Pro (9.7-inch) }
                    { platform:iOS Simulator, id:F3FE571B-0B6A-4DCB-8F3A-A7DFBF80AB4A, OS:15.0, name:iPad Pro (11-inch) (2nd generation) }
                    { platform:iOS Simulator, id:F53FBBB3-E7CF-44D4-895B-E1224502E6D5, OS:15.0, name:iPad Pro (11-inch) (3rd generation) }
                    { platform:iOS Simulator, id:957B76DB-3BF1-4EDC-8A49-979E9C29C5CA, OS:12.4, name:iPad Pro (12.9-inch) }
                    { platform:iOS Simulator, id:DD9469D8-2641-43C1-9C90-E66FB901C9A7, OS:12.4, name:iPad Pro (12.9-inch) (2nd generation) }
                    { platform:iOS Simulator, id:04859A3A-62AA-4865-9173-669E06A2D5B0, OS:12.4, name:iPad Pro (12.9-inch) (3rd generation) }
                    { platform:iOS Simulator, id:EE79D7D2-8EA8-4C67-8E06-BEA665D1B044, OS:15.0, name:iPad Pro (12.9-inch) (4th generation) }
                    { platform:iOS Simulator, id:602341EF-E534-4DE1-8A7B-E6F4A86501EA, OS:15.0, name:iPad Pro (12.9-inch) (5th generation) }
                    { platform:iOS Simulator, id:C9DE2F54-C0B6-4FF2-A34C-E2B0E29F2EB7, OS:12.4, name:iPhone 5s }
                    { platform:iOS Simulator, id:F34B0CAD-75A7-41A7-BF2A-26C625535FC6, OS:12.4, name:iPhone 6 }
                    { platform:iOS Simulator, id:EBB74968-47AD-456B-BA8B-3A58BE85F302, OS:12.4, name:iPhone 6 Plus }
                    { platform:iOS Simulator, id:084ECAE7-FE00-42D9-A68E-90F3BDCC68B0, OS:12.4, name:iPhone 6s }
                    { platform:iOS Simulator, id:36DED3AA-D9B0-4BBA-9448-B3E199121CE0, OS:12.4, name:iPhone 6s Plus }
                    { platform:iOS Simulator, id:61727199-6726-4FFB-A573-9731BBA33D97, OS:12.4, name:iPhone 7 }
                    { platform:iOS Simulator, id:EEFCCF18-66FB-426A-A24B-F93FBE280701, OS:12.4, name:iPhone 7 Plus }
                    { platform:iOS Simulator, id:1FB04F3A-9F57-4640-B2F3-873286905C6B, OS:12.4, name:iPhone 8 }
                    { platform:iOS Simulator, id:E880E841-53DB-4DFA-A8F3-FF62BE6B1A98, OS:15.0, name:iPhone 8 }
                    { platform:iOS Simulator, id:E536FBE2-3229-4CD7-843C-C60C8F2B42B2, OS:12.4, name:iPhone 8 Plus }
                    { platform:iOS Simulator, id:E63058E7-1364-46C4-87F8-04399CD5A450, OS:15.0, name:iPhone 8 Plus }
                    { platform:iOS Simulator, id:93513EF9-38EC-458B-90CB-F44A445A6679, OS:15.0, name:iPhone 11 }
                    { platform:iOS Simulator, id:8C016096-1BFC-4A6C-8D36-0B68613D2F47, OS:15.0, name:iPhone 11 Pro }
                    { platform:iOS Simulator, id:BFB1792A-351D-492D-899E-B32C23B42195, OS:15.0, name:iPhone 11 Pro Max }
                    { platform:iOS Simulator, id:B2747785-28C2-405E-B4E4-B313E96EEE73, OS:15.0, name:iPhone 12 }
                    { platform:iOS Simulator, id:023833E0-FBEE-4C0C-A75F-7EDCB5A9E026, OS:15.0, name:iPhone 12 Pro }
                    { platform:iOS Simulator, id:82446409-3964-428A-8563-5AA08CAE91F0, OS:15.0, name:iPhone 12 Pro Max }
                    { platform:iOS Simulator, id:5C67E759-20F9-4D25-A03F-E1FA57EF2E48, OS:15.0, name:iPhone 12 mini }
                    { platform:iOS Simulator, id:FFFC335F-EAAC-416A-81EF-596496383CCE, OS:12.4, name:iPhone SE }
                    { platform:iOS Simulator, id:FA946A85-41AB-491F-9159-64A9BF9578E1, OS:15.0, name:iPhone SE (2nd generation) }
                    { platform:iOS Simulator, id:C9A36DF7-7034-48B5-AE15-2AA8E3F84B79, OS:12.4, name:iPhone X }
                    { platform:iOS Simulator, id:BEE28698-093D-4489-A503-B5F8CDC33B8B, OS:12.4, name:iPhone Xs }
                    { platform:iOS Simulator, id:FD60F847-4E6E-4320-8212-9B90606FA573, OS:12.4, name:iPhone Xs Max }
                    { platform:iOS Simulator, id:97114501-3851-4C01-8814-159668DBBBA9, OS:12.4, name:iPhone Xʀ }
                    { platform:iOS Simulator, id:8096AF99-4A7B-49AE-A956-5FE6AF8C07A6, OS:15.0, name:iPod touch (7th generation) }
[  +86 ms]  └─Compiling, linking and signing... (completed in 4.0s)
[        ] Xcode build done.                                            7.5s

The app successfully builds.

This does not reproduce on Xcode 12. See also #86590.

$ flutter doctor -v
[✓] Flutter (Channel unknown, 2.4.0-5.0.pre.241, on macOS 11.4 20F71 darwin-x64, locale en-US)
    • Flutter version 2.4.0-5.0.pre.241 at /Users/magder/Projects/flutter
    • Upstream repository unknown
    • Framework revision 81b46443da (4 days ago), 2021-07-23 17:18:47 -0700
    • Engine revision 66ae7a368c
    • Dart version 2.14.0 (build 2.14.0-356.0.dev)

[✓] Xcode - develop for iOS and macOS
    • Xcode at /Users/magder/Applications/Xcode-13_beta3.app/Contents/Developer
    • Xcode 13.0, Build version 13A5192i
    • CocoaPods version 1.10.1

[✓] Connected device (5 available)
    • iPad (mobile)      • 00008027-001925360106802E                • ios            • iOS 15.0 19A5281j
    • iPhone 6s (mobile) • d83d5bc53967baa0ee18626ba87b6254b2ab5418 • ios            • iOS 13.7 17H35
    • iPhone 11 (mobile) • 93513EF9-38EC-458B-90CB-F44A445A6679     • ios            • com.apple.CoreSimulator.SimRuntime.iOS-15-0 (simulator)
    • macOS (desktop)    • macos                                    • darwin-x64     • macOS 11.4 20F71 darwin-x64
    • Chrome (web)       • chrome                                   • web-javascript • Google Chrome 92.0.4515.107

• No issues found!

Metadata

Metadata

Assignees

No one assigned

    Labels

    P2Important issues not at the top of the work listplatform-iosiOS applications specificallyt: xcode"xcodebuild" on iOS and general Xcode project managementteam-iosOwned by iOS platform teamtoolAffects the "flutter" command-line tool. See also t: labels.triaged-iosTriaged by iOS platform team

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ions